> So Curve25519 needs a standard OID and some notes on the format to use for 
> ASN.1. Does such a thing exist?

I don't think so.  Perhaps the TLS list is the place to discuss this?  Should 
we (I?) start a thread there on a proposal to fit Curve25519 into common TLS 
usage?

Strawman proposal:
        The keys are OCTET STRING (or does BIGNUM fit better with existing 
code?)
        Y is fixed at zero
        An OID is assigned from the IETF arc

Anything else missing?
